                   ORDERS FOR TUESDAY, JULY 22, 2014

  Mr. DURBIN. I ask unanimous consent that when the Senate completes 
its business today, it adjourn until 10 a.m. on Tuesday, July 22, 2014; 
that following the prayer and pledge, the morning hour be deemed 
expired, the Journal of proceedings be approved to date, and the time 
for the two leaders be reserved for their use later in the day; that 
following any leader remarks, the Senate be in a period of morning 
business until 10:45 a.m., with Senators permitted to speak therein for 
up to 10 minutes each, with the time equally divided and controlled 
between the two leaders or their designees; that at 10:45 a.m. the 
Senate proceed to executive session as provided under the previous 
order; further, that following the vote on the deGravelles nomination, 
the time until 12:30 p.m. be equally divided and controlled in the 
usual form; and finally, that the Senate recess from 12:30 p.m. until 
2:15 p.m. to allow for the weekly caucus meetings.
  The PRESIDING OFFICER. Without objection, it is so ordered.
